I hope you (and more importantly, he) are aware of university policy about romantic or sexual relationships between faculty and students. There's no problem if you're not in any of his classes, or if he isn't your supervisor, but otherwise I would be super careful until you graduate. Also, it's very common for students to develop a crush on a professor, and for an unscrupulous professor (and I'm not saying he is) to take advantage of female students.

I say this partly as a standard precaution about any academic romances, but also because with this man's Venus, Mars, Pluto, and sun conjunction he probably derives a sense of power (Mars, Pluto) from romantic encounters (Venus.) Planets conjunct the sun indicate what the person identifies with (sun=identity.) With his independent moon-Chiron opposite Uranus, he may have difficulty in staying faithful. Uranus rules change and the moon gives one's emotional nature.

Synastry can show if people are compatible, but then we also need to look at whether or how people are relationship material independently of the relationship.

chasama, I don't know where you live or how closely you have interacted with fellow students. But "Professor Romeo" exists in many universities, and oftentimes he is married.

Generally if he's a repeat romancer, the other older students know about his reputation. Discrete inquiries may be helpful, because I just don't see faithfulness being this man's strength, for reasons I outlined above. Possibly you may want nothing more than a short-term casual fling yourself. But the problem is that if word gets out that if a student and her professor are intimately involved, and s/he is this professor's own student in a class or supervisor relationship, it can cause a lot of resentment among fellow students-- who tend to feel that the love interest is getting special preferential treatment that they don't have. I've also heard gossip years after the alleged incident about female students sleeping their way to professional academic success, and it isn't pretty.

(I'm a retired academic, BTW.)

With your vertex conjunct this man's Libra stellium, I think he is bound to have a very powerful influence over you, and the student-professor relationship will probably seem to have a fated quality. But taking a step into an actual romantic relationship is a different matter, and it may or may not be a good idea.
